How does a real estate agent invoice or document a commission?

Agents are usually paid a commission at closing, settled through the closing statement rather than a standard invoice, but a written commission statement is still useful. Name the property, the sale price, the commission rate, and any split or referral fee. Record the closing date so the figure ties back to the transaction.

Your invoice needs the property address, sale price, and commission percentage so everyone can verify the math. Include the closing date because that is when your commission actually became due. Add your brokerage name and license number since some states require it and title companies want everything matching their records. Break out any splits with other agents or brokerages right on the invoice to avoid confusion later.

Most real estate commissions get paid at closing through the title company or escrow holder. You do not invoice beforehand or chase payment afterward. The closing statement shows your commission, and the title company cuts your check the same day. If you are doing property management or consulting work outside of sales, then you will invoice monthly with net 15 or net 30 terms.

Send your W-9 to the title company as soon as the contract goes firm. Waiting until closing day means your payment gets delayed while they process paperwork. Also, double check that your invoice matches the commission amount on the settlement statement before closing happens. Fixing a mismatch after everyone has signed takes weeks and makes you look sloppy.

Typical line items

  • Sales commission (percentage of sale price)
  • Buyer or seller agent share
  • Referral fee paid or received
  • Brokerage split
  • Transaction or admin fee
  • Marketing and listing costs
  • Staging or photography reimbursement
  • Closing date and property reference

How the work is charged

Real estate agents are typically paid a commission set as a percentage of the sale price, often split between the buyer and seller sides and again with the brokerage. Some charge flat or transaction fees instead, and commission is negotiable.

Payment terms and deposits

Commission is usually paid at closing from the sale proceeds, handled through the settlement statement. Referral fees between agents are settled per their written agreement.

Tax and compliance

If you are registered for sales tax or VAT, show it as a separate line with your registration number. Commission income and any fees are taxed and regulated differently by region, so confirm what applies to you.

Frequently asked questions

When do real estate agents use invoices vs. commission?

Most residential agents earn commission at closing. Invoices are used for consulting fees, flat-fee services, property management, or when commission structures require documentation.

What should a real estate invoice include?

Include property address, service type, dates of service, hours (if consulting), any expenses advanced (photography, staging, advertising), and reference to any commission agreements.

Can real estate agents charge consulting fees?

Yes. Many agents offer hourly consulting ($100–$300) for buyers not yet ready to transact, investor advisory, or relocation assistance. This is separate from commission-based work.
